Guest post- Five Outdoor Essentials No Garden Should Be Without!

The
garden can mean different things to different people. Some might only use their
outdoor space when the weather is nice and they want to do some sunbathing,
while others will be out there every day, rain or shine, engaging in a bit of
outdoor exercise. Many people plant flowers, of course, but plenty of others
get a lot of pleasure from their garden without even knowing their azaleas from
their elbow.








Still,
no matter what your outdoor living space is to you, there are a few
garden products that everyone should
have. Here are five such items; as outdoor essentials go, these ones are the
most essential of all. Some are crucial to getting the most out of your garden,
while others are just for fun, but either way, no good garden should be without
them.





1.  Bird Feeder





Bird feeders are fairly inexpensive, and aside from the
occasional refill, they require almost no effort on your part. You do not have
to be a die-hard ornithologist to bring a flurry of beautiful birds to your
garden; all you need to do is hang up a bird feeder, chase away any cats that
might be prowling along your garden wall, and wait for your feathered friends
to arrive! Anything that holds seeds will do, although it is well worth paying a
little more for an attractive, brightly-colored bird feeder. That way, you will
be adding a beautiful decoration to your garden as well as giving the birds a
good place to eat!





2. Garden Lights




You
would not want your living room or your kitchen to be sans lighting, so why keep your garden in the dark? There is a
plethora of great garden lighting products available, ranging from the inexpensive and functional to the extravagant and eye-catching. Whatever your budget is,
it is always worth investing in a bit of illumination for your outdoor space;
even if you opt for the cheapest, most bog-standard garden lamps you can find,
at least you will be able to see your way around the garden after the sun goes
down.





3.  Water Feature




We are
starting to get a little more indulgent now, but it is impossible to imagine a
garden that would not benefit from the presence of a beautiful, bubbling water
feature. They make lovely ornaments on their own, but a water feature’s real
appeal is the water (obviously). Gazing at the gentle cascade for a few minutes
can be a great way to unwind, and even if you are focused on something else when
you are out in the garden, there is no lovelier background noise than the soft
babbling of a water feature in full flow. It is all about the 
ambiance!






4. Swing Seat




From
plastic lawn furniture to a squishy outdoor bean bag, there are plenty of ways
to take a seat in the garden. Everyone will have a different preference when it
comes to outdoor seating solutions, but there is one thing that pretty much
everyone has in common: we all love a swing seat! There is something about the
gentle back-and-forth motion that appeals to a very primal part of the human
brain, and if you want a spot where you can sit and read a book - or just
somewhere to relax after a hard day’s gardening - then a swing seat is ideal. A
hammock will also make a fine addition to any outdoor space; it has that same
superb swing to it, and makes the perfect place for a snooze when the summer
sun is shining.





5. Barbecue




The final
outdoor essential on this list is unlikely to be something you use very
frequently, but you will surely agree that anyone with a garden should have a barbecue
on standby. You never know when the weather might suddenly warm up, and when it
does, the guy (or girl) with the barbecue always becomes the most popular
person in town!
